
privacy professionals
Privacy professionals are experts who help organizations protect individuals' personal information. They develop policies, implement practices, and ensure compliance with laws related to data privacy. Their goal is to balance the organization's needs with respecting individuals' rights to keep their information secure and private. By managing risks, training staff, and responding to privacy concerns, they help maintain trust and avoid legal issues. In essence, privacy professionals serve as guardians of sensitive data, ensuring that personal information is handled responsibly and ethically across all business activities.
